The Righteous Speak Wisdom ( Psalm 37:30-31 )

The mouth of the righteous speaketh wisdom, and his tongue talketh of judgment.

The law of his God is in his heart; none of his steps shall slide.

Psalm 37:30-31

-------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------

In the book of proverbs it says the beginning of wisdom is the fear of the Lord( Proverbs 1:7 ). A righteous man or woman fears the Lord and that reverence will show in the way he or she speaks. This comes through reading and getting deep in the Word. The Bible is not just a book you carry with you to church on Sunday, no it is so much more. It is everything we need, in fact the apostle Paul described it as a weapon( Ephesians 6:17 ) against our enemy the devil. Notice anytime Jesus spoke, it made people think. They either liked it or they didn't. The truth was those who didn't like it, most likely were doing what He was talking about. In verse 31 it says that law of his God is in his heart, none of his steps shall slide. So what does this mean? What this means is by having God's law in our hearts that a righteous man or woman steps won't slide. Now does this mean we won't make mistakes ? No,but it does mean we won't willfully sin.
